    Gerontology Courses at UNR

    The Gerontology Certificate Program is nationally recognized as a Program of Merit by the Association for Gerontology in Higher Education (AGHE). This official "stamp of approval" validates the high quality of our courses and faculty which prepare students to work directly with older adults. We are the first undergraduate certificate program in the country to achieve this important distinct honor.

    Senior Outreach Services Volunteer Recognition Event

    On May 9, 2012 SOS held a Volunteer Remembrance Luncheon. Debbie Enos, Resource Development Specialist with the ADSD presented Robert Fontana with the SOS Volunteer Service Award. Robert is 92 years old and currently still an active SOS volunteer as he has been for the past 10 years.

    RSVP Luncheon Celebrates the Impact of Volunteers

    The Retired and Senior Volunteer Program (RSVP) of Washoe County celebrated the impact of its volunteers in the community at the annual Volunteer Recognition Luncheon held at John Ascuaga's Nugget on Friday, November 2, 2012.
